Do prayers work research?

At least one earlier study found lower complication rates in patients who received intercessory prayers; others found no difference. A 1997 study at the University of New Mexico, involving 40 alcoholics in rehabilitation, found that the men and women who knew they were being prayed for actually fared worse.

What are the five most common coping strategies that have been identified for cancer patients?

The most common coping strategies were religion, acceptance, self-distraction, planning, active coping, positive reframing and denial.

What role does spirituality play in the recovery of cancer patients?

Cancer patients report their spirituality helps them find hope, gratitude, and positivity in their cancer experience [26– 28], and that their spirituality is a source of strength that helps them cope, find meaning in their lives, and make sense of the cancer experience as they recover from treatment [29].

Is cancer curable yet?

Treatment. There are no cures for any kinds of cancer, but there are treatments that may cure you. Many people are treated for cancer, live out the rest of their life, and die of other causes. Many others are treated for cancer and still die from it, although treatment may give them more time: even years or decades.

What happens to your brain when you pray?

And Your Reality Scans show that people who spend untold hours in prayer or meditation go dark in the parietal lobe, the brain area that helps create a sense of self. A researcher says these people may be rewriting the neural connections in their brains — altering how they see the world.

Can prayer cure cancer?

Studies have found that spirituality, religion, and prayer are very important to quality of life for some people who have been diagnosed with cancer. Research has not shown that spirituality and prayer can cure cancer or any other disease, but they may be a helpful addition to conventional medical care.
